Marist Splits Day One of Marist Invite

March 24, 2001 -- The Marist College Polo team picked up its first win at home with a 10-8 win over St. Francis College at the Marist College Invitational at the James J. McCann Natatorium. Earlier in the day, the Red Foxes fell to powerhouse Hartwick, 2-11.

Marist, which currently stands at 2-11 on the season, were led in the win by rookie Alyson Fiorillo (Pottsville, PA) with five goals, including three in the second period. Freshman Jen Meyer (Fairport, NY) also added two goals, while netminder Jessica Lengyel (Beacon Falls, CT) made eight saves in the home victory.

In the loss, rookie Joelle Evanousky (Barnesville, PA) and sophomore captain Kristina Estok (Orange, CT) each netted a goal. Lengyel saved five Hartwick shots on net.
